Nick Hillary Net Worth in 2026 (Detailed Analysis)

Nick Hillary’s net worth has not been officially declared publicly. Some non-credible sources have claimed that his net worth is between $1M and $3M.

Update (March 26, 2026): Public sources don’t list Nick Hillary’s exact salary. He served as an assistant at St. Lawrence (2007–2009) and head coach at Clarkson (2009–2014). Recent school reports show men’s head-coach averages at Clarkson around $69k–$76k in EADA filings, and St. Lawrence head-coach averages near $85.7k (program-wide, not soccer-specific). With no major business ventures on record, a $1–3 million net-worth estimate remains reasonable.

Nick Hillary Garrett Phillips Case & Its Financial Impact

Nick Hillary is a former college soccer player, coach, and academic professional, widely known for his coaching career at St. Lawrence and Clarkson Universities, and for the highly publicized Garrett Phillips case, in which he was acquitted in 2016.

From a financial perspective, the case likely resulted in:

  • Lost coaching income during legal proceedings.
  • Legal defense costs.
  • Reduced future earning opportunities due to public attention.

How Did Nick Hillary Build His Net Worth?

Nick Hillary’s estimated net worth of $1 million to $3 million wasn’t built through business deals or endorsements.

It came from nearly three decades of steady work, military service, high school teaching, and college soccer coaching.

His peak earning years were during his time as head coach at Clarkson University, where public EADA filings show head coaches in men’s sports earning around $69,000 – $76,000 per year.

Legal proceedings after 2014 likely created significant career disruption and added financial strain through defense costs.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

What happened to Nick Hillary?

Nick Hillary was found innocent in the case of the murder of a 12-year-old boy. He has struggled a lot during and after the case.

What happened to Garrett Phillips?

Garrett Phillips was reportedly murdered in his apartment. He was found strangled in his apartment in Potsdam in 2011.  

Did Nick Hillary do it?

No. Nick did not murder Garrett Phillips. He went through a non-jury trial, and the judge declared Nick to be innocent of the murder case.

Did Nick Hillary win his lawsuit?

No. Nick reportedly lost his lawsuit that he filed after being declared innocent.

What is Nick Hillary doing now?

Currently, Nick is trying to rebuild his life after the Garrett Phillips case. He has been keeping a low profile after being declared innocent.

Where does Nick Hillary live now?

Currently, Nick is living in Potsdam, New York. Although he has been declared innocent, he has kept a low profile recently.

Did Nick Hillary receive any settlement money?

There is no confirmed public record of Nick Hillary receiving a settlement. While he filed a civil rights lawsuit after his acquittal, reports suggest that the case did not result in a financial payout.
